Comprehending the Intricate Anatomy of the Ear and Its Susceptibility to Infections
Diving into the Functional Dynamics of the Ear
The ear is an extraordinarily complex organ, segmented into three main regions: the outer ear, middle ear, and inner ear. Each of these sections is essential for the process of hearing. The outer ear, consisting of the pinna and ear canal, is responsible for capturing sound waves and funneling them towards the eardrum. When sound waves hit the eardrum, they induce vibrations. These vibrations are subsequently transmitted to the middle ear, which houses three tiny bones collectively known as the ossicles: the malleus, incus, and stapes. These ossicles amplify the sound vibrations before relaying them to the inner ear, enabling us to perceive a vast spectrum of sounds.
Infections have the potential to disrupt this intricate auditory process at any phase. For instance, otitis media, a prevalent infection of the middle ear, results in fluid accumulation that obstructs the ossicles’ ability to effectively transmit sound. This disruption may lead to temporary or, in some cases, permanent hearing loss. Gaining a thorough understanding of the ear’s structure and its functional mechanisms is vital for recognising how infections can adversely affect hearing.
Recognising the Various Types of Ear Infections
Ear infections are primarily classified into three major types: otitis externa, Otitis media, and otitis interna. Otitis externa, commonly known as swimmer’s ear, impacts the outer ear canal and is frequently caused by exposure to water, resulting in inflammation and discomfort. Although this type of infection might not directly lead to hearing loss, it can create discomfort and temporary auditory disturbances that can disrupt daily activities.
Otitis media is more commonly encountered and occurs in the middle ear, often as a sequel to respiratory infections. This condition can result in fluid build-up, which can cause significant hearing impairment. Symptoms typically encompass ear pain, fever, and irritability, particularly in children. If untreated, otitis media can lead to chronic inflammation, adversely affecting hearing in the long term. Otitis interna, also referred to as labyrinthitis, affects the inner ear and is less frequent. It can result in sensorineural hearing loss by damaging the cochlea. Such infections may arise from either viral or bacterial origins, which underscores the importance of prevention and early detection in maintaining auditory health and overall well-being.
Grasping the Sound Transmission Pathway within the Ear
Sound waves traverse a defined route within the ear. They first enter the ear canal and strike the eardrum, initiating vibrations. This vibration is then conveyed to the ossicles in the middle ear, which amplify the sound and pass it along to the inner ear. The cochlea, a coiled structure within the inner ear, converts these vibrations into electrical signals that are transmitted to the brain, enabling us to perceive sound and appreciate the nuances of auditory experiences.
Infections can disrupt this pathway by inducing fluid accumulation or inflammation. For example, an otitis media infection might obstruct the eustachian tube, hindering pressure equalisation within the middle ear. This blockage can distort sound transmission, resulting in muffled hearing or discomfort during pressure fluctuations, such as when flying. Understanding the sound pathway is essential for illustrating how infections can lead to hearing loss and emphasising the necessity of prompt treatment to preserve auditory function and improve quality of life.
Investigating the Mechanisms by Which Infections Induce Hearing Loss
How Do Infections Affect the Eardrum and Auditory Function?
Infections can profoundly impact the eardrum, giving rise to various complications that may hinder hearing. When an infection occurs, the eardrum may become inflamed or, in severe instances, develop a perforation. A perforated eardrum can directly diminish sound transmission efficiency, resulting in temporary or even permanent hearing loss. Symptoms indicative of eardrum damage often include ear pain, discomfort, fluid drainage from the ear canal, hearing loss or muffled auditory perception, and tinnitus, which is often described as a ringing sound in the ear.
Inflammation might also cause the eardrum to thicken and lose flexibility, impairing its ability to vibrate correctly. An inflamed eardrum becomes less responsive to sound waves, resulting in decreased auditory perception. The effects of these symptoms can vary; for some individuals, they may be temporary, while others may face enduring hearing difficulties if the infection is not addressed swiftly. Recognising these consequences highlights the importance of prompt action in managing ear infections.
What Occurs in the Middle Ear During an Infection?
During an ear infection, particularly otitis media, the middle ear may become filled with fluid. This fluid accumulation exerts pressure and inhibits the ossicles from vibrating adequately, which is crucial for sound transmission. The presence of fluid alters the normal movement of these bones, resulting in a substantial decline in hearing capability and overall auditory performance.
The fluid build-up can also foster an environment conducive to further infections and inflammation. As the infection progresses, the likelihood of chronic otitis media rises, potentially leading to long-term complications and persistent auditory challenges. If left untreated, the pressure created by the fluid may even result in eardrum rupture. Thus, preventing fluid accumulation and treating middle ear infections is vital for safeguarding hearing health and ensuring a clear auditory pathway.
Appreciating the Inner Ear’s Contribution to Hearing Loss
The inner ear is pivotal in converting sound vibrations into electrical signals that the brain interprets. The cochlea, a fundamental part of the inner ear, can be vulnerable to damage from infections, especially in severe or chronic cases. Any damage to the cochlea can lead to sensorineural hearing loss, often marked by a lasting decrease in hearing ability that can significantly diminish quality of life.
Infections may prompt inflammation and other structural alterations within the cochlea, compromising sound processing capabilities. If the hair cells within the cochlea sustain damage, they may not regenerate, leading to persistent hearing loss. This situation underscores the necessity of addressing infections promptly and effectively to safeguard the delicate structures of the inner ear, ultimately preserving auditory health.

What Are the Long-Term Consequences of Untreated Infections?
Neglected ear infections can lead to chronic conditions that result in long-term hearing loss and other complications. Over time, recurrent infections can inflict damage on the ear’s structures, especially the eardrum and ossicles, creating a series of problems that may be irreversible and significantly impact auditory perception.
Comprehending the potential long-term consequences is vital for prevention. Chronic otitis media can result in persistent fluid in the middle ear, which may not only impair hearing but also contribute to speech delays in children. Furthermore, untreated infections can markedly increase the risk of developing conditions like cholesteatoma, a destructive skin growth in the middle ear that can erode bones and further compromise hearing. Awareness of these risks encourages proactive measures for treatment and management, alleviating the burden of hearing loss and its associated challenges.

How Does Inflammation Contribute to Hearing Loss?
Inflammation plays a critical role in the damage caused by ear infections. When the body reacts to an infection, it triggers an inflammatory response that can lead to swelling and irritation in the ear. This inflammation may harm delicate structures within the ear, including the eardrum, ossicles, and cochlea, resulting in auditory problems.
Understanding this process is essential for managing ear infections and preventing hearing loss. For example, persistent inflammation can lead to scarring of the eardrum, impairing its ability to vibrate properly. Additionally, the inflammatory response can compromise blood flow to the inner ear, further escalating the risk of permanent damage. Effective management of inflammation, through both medical interventions and lifestyle adjustments, can significantly enhance outcomes for those at risk of hearing loss and promote overall ear health.

How Do Healthcare Professionals Diagnose Ear Infections?
Diagnosing ear infections typically involves a comprehensive physical examination by a healthcare provider. Otoscopy is a standard method employed to inspect the ear canal and eardrum for indications of inflammation or fluid accumulation. This examination enables the doctor to ascertain the presence of an infection based on visual cues, ensuring an accurate diagnosis.
Additional diagnostic tools may include tympanometry, which evaluates the movement of the eardrum and the functionality of the middle ear. This test can help quantify the extent of fluid accumulation or pressure changes within the ear. Accurate diagnosis is vital for effective treatment, as it informs the selection of interventions, whether they involve antibiotics, pain management, or further assessment. Proper diagnosis constitutes a crucial step in ensuring that patients receive the most effective and appropriate care for their ear health.

What Role Do Ear Tubes Play in Managing Recurrent Infections?
Ear tubes serve as a viable treatment option for children who experience recurrent ear infections. These small tubes are inserted into the eardrum to facilitate drainage of fluid from the middle ear, alleviating pressure and promoting healing. The presence of ear tubes can significantly enhance hearing in children suffering from chronic infections, supporting better auditory development and overall quality of life.
By providing a pathway for fluid to escape, ear tubes help prevent complications that could lead to hearing loss. They also reduce the frequency of infections by ensuring continuous ventilation in the middle ear. Parents considering this option often find it beneficial in managing their child’s ear health, especially when traditional treatments have proven inadequate in addressing recurring ear issues.
Can Surgical Intervention Be Necessary for Severe Ear Infections?
In severe cases of ear infections, surgical intervention may be required. Procedures such as tympanostomy, which entails the placement of ear tubes, or even tympanoplasty, aimed at repairing the eardrum, may become crucial when conventional treatments fail. These surgeries can be essential for restoring hearing function and preventing further complications, particularly in instances where chronic infections have led to considerable damage.
Surgical interventions can provide immediate relief from persistent fluid accumulation and infection. In many cases, these procedures yield improved hearing outcomes, especially in children who are notably vulnerable to the effects of ear infections. The decision to pursue surgery is typically made after thorough consideration of the patient’s medical history, the frequency of infections, and the current level of hearing impairment, ensuring the best possible outcome.

The Impact of Vaccinations on Preventing Ear Infections
Vaccinations serve as a crucial preventive measure against pathogens responsible for ear infections. Vaccines for influenza, pneumococcal disease, and Haemophilus influenzae type b (Hib) have shown effectiveness in diminishing the incidence of ear infections, particularly among children who are at a greater risk.
By reducing the likelihood of respiratory infections that can lead to otitis media, vaccinations play a substantial role in preserving hearing health. Public health campaigns that advocate for vaccination can significantly reduce ear infection rates globally. Parents are encouraged to stay informed regarding vaccination schedules to ensure their children receive the necessary immunisations for optimal health and protection against infections.

Frequently Asked Questions Regarding Ear Infections
What are the prevalent causes of ear infections?
Ear infections are commonly caused by bacteria or viruses, often following respiratory infections. Allergies, sinus infections, and anatomical factors can also contribute to the development of ear infections, underscoring the importance of understanding potential triggers.
How can I determine if I have an ear infection?
Common indicators of an ear infection include ear pain, fever, fluid drainage, and difficulty hearing. If you experience these symptoms, consulting a healthcare provider is essential for diagnosis and treatment, ensuring prompt care to prevent complications.
Are ear infections prevalent in children?
Yes, ear infections are particularly common in children due to their developing immune systems and the anatomical structure of their eustachian tubes, which makes them more susceptible to blockages and infections that can affect their hearing.
Can ear infections result in permanent hearing loss?
Yes, if left untreated or if recurrent, ear infections can lead to permanent hearing loss due to damage to the eardrum or middle ear bones. Early treatment is critical to preventing long-term complications and preserving auditory function.
What is the most effective treatment for ear infections?
The optimal treatment often depends on the type and severity of the infection. Antibiotics may be prescribed for bacterial infections, while pain relievers can assist in alleviating symptoms. In chronic cases, surgical intervention may be necessary to restore normal ear function and hearing.
How can I prevent ear infections?
Preventive measures encompass practising good hygiene, maintaining up-to-date vaccinations, and avoiding exposure to smoke and allergens. Regular hearing assessments can also help monitor risk factors, ensuring timely intervention when needed.
When should I consult a doctor for an ear infection?
You should seek medical advice if you experience persistent ear pain, fever, drainage from the ear, or if symptoms do not improve within a few days. Prompt medical attention can prevent complications and protect hearing health.
Can adults experience ear infections?
Yes, while ear infections are more prevalent in children, adults can also develop them, particularly following upper respiratory infections or sinusitis that can lead to inflammation and blockage in the ear.
What is the significance of antibiotics in treating ear infections?
Antibiotics are effective in treating bacterial ear infections, aiding in the elimination of infection and reducing inflammation. However, they are ineffective against viral infections, which necessitate different management strategies.
How frequently should children undergo hearing tests?
Children should have hearing tests routinely, especially if they are at risk for ear infections. Pediatricians typically recommend screenings at critical developmental stages or if there are concerns about hearing to ensure timely intervention.
